G1 als USB-Modem ohne Root auf dem MAC

Vor wenigen Tagen habe ich erklärt, wie man das T-Mobile G1 als Modem nutzen kann. Dies fuznktioniert leider nur auf einem Windows PC. Dank phantom aus unserem Forum ist es nun möglich, dass T-Mobile G1 als USB-Modem ohne Root auch auf einem PC mit Macintosh OS zu nutzen. Ich als Windows-Nutzer kann zur Anleitung wenig sagen, aber ich bin sicher bei Problemen wird euch Phantom in den Kommentaren oder im Forum helfen.

Hier nun die Anleitung von “phantom” wie man das G1 zu Modem auf einem MAC macht:

Urls:
- Treiber und ADB Tool: http://developer.android.com/sdk/1.1_r1/index.html
- MacPorts: http://www.macports.org/install.php
- Azilink: http://lfx.org/azilink/azilink.apk

auf dem G1:
- im G1 unter Einstellungen / Anwendungen / Unbekannte Quellen aktivieren
- im G1 unter Einstellungen / Anwendungen / Entwicklung / USB Debugging aktivieren
- http://lfx.org/azilink/azilink.apk im G1-Browser aufrufen
- Azilink installieren

auf dem MAC:
- Android SDK in ein beliebiges Verzeichnis installieren
- MacPorts installieren

- Pfad vom tools-Ordner in den Systempfad aufnehmen
a.) Terminal öffnen
b.) “cd” eingeben ohne Anführungszeichen
c.) “open -a TextEdit .profile” eingeben
d.) Pfad vom tools-Ordner hinzufügen. Mein Pfad lautet z.B. wie folgt: /Developer/android-sdk-mac_x86-1.1_r1/tools

mein “export PATH”
export PATH=/opt/local/bin:/opt/local/sbin:$PATH:/Developer/android-sdk-mac_x86-1.1_r1/tools

e.) speichern

- openVPN2 installieren

a.) Terminal öffnen
b.) “sudo port” eingeben
c.) Passwort eingeben
d.) “install openvpn2″ eingeben

- Im Browser öffnen:
http://forum.xda-developers.com/showpos … stcount=24 (Danke für das Script an mochabyte)

a.) ganz unten den Link öffnen (http://pastie.org/405289)
b.) Texteditor öffnen (z.B. EMACS, NANO, AQUAEMACS, TEXTEDIT)
c.) Script in den Editor kopieren und im Userverzeichnis unter dem Namen “modem” abspeichern:

Anleitung G1 Mac Modem
d.) Terminal öffnen
e.) “cd” eingeben um ins Userverzeichnis zu wechseln
f.) “chmod 755 modem” eingeben (Userrechte für das Script werden gesetzt)

Jetzt ab ins Netz:
- G1 mit dem MAC verbinden
- Azilink am G1 starten:
a.) “Service active” (Checkbox anklicken)

Azilink G1
- Terminal öffnen
a.) in das Verzeichnis wechseln, in welchem die “modem” Datei liegt (Userverzeichnis)
b.) “./modem” eingeben
c.) Script ermöglicht eine Verbindung mit dem Netz

- Fertig

Falls irgendwo in der Anleitung ein oder mehrere Fehler vorhanden sind, bitte melden, bei Phantom klappt es auf jedenfall! Vielen Dank. Hier geht es zur Quelle aus dem Link: Android Smartphone Forum.

Trage diesen Artikel in Social Dienste ein
  • MisterWong.DE
  • Digg
  • Webnews.de
  • del.icio.us
  • MySpace
  • Facebook
  • Mixx
  • LinkArena
  • Sphinn
  • Google
  • LinkedIn
  • Live
  • Wikio
  • Yigg
Dieser Eintrag wurde am Dienstag, April 7th, 2009 um 11:23 veröffentlicht.
Kategorie: Android Apps, Android OS.

8 Kommentare

  1. Phantom

    Es ist unter Umständen notwendig nach ” install openvpn2 ” — ” install tuntaposx ” einzugeben, um die tuntap kernel extention zu installieren, welches die Erstellung eines virtuellen Netzwerkinterfaces ermöglicht.

    Danke für den Tipp an kwaH aus dem Forum.

  2. Oliver

    Hallo zusammen,

    nach 3 Stunden googlen und probieren gebe ich auf… Ich bekomme immer untenstehende Fehlermeldung. Weiß jemand Rat? Ich haben Leopard (10.5) installiert und bin die Anleitung Schritt für Schritt durchgegangen. “tuntaposx” habe ich aufgrund des Hinweises von PHANTOM nachinstalliert.

    laptop-oliver-wifi:~ mac$ ./modem
    Thu Sep 10 14:58:53 2009 OpenVPN 2.0.9 i686-apple-darwin9.8.0 [SSL] [LZO] built on Sep 10 2009
    Thu Sep 10 14:58:53 2009 IMPORTANT: OpenVPN’s default port number is now 1194, based on an official port number assignment by IANA. OpenVPN 2.0-beta16 and earlier used 5000 as the default port.
    Thu Sep 10 14:58:53 2009 ******* WARNING *******: all encryption and authentication features disabled — all data will be tunnelled as cleartext
    Thu Sep 10 14:58:53 2009 gw 192.168.4.1
    Thu Sep 10 14:58:53 2009 Cannot allocate TUN/TAP dev dynamically
    Thu Sep 10 14:58:53 2009 Exiting

    Viele Grüße
    Oliver

  3. grindlfuzz

    hast du tuntaposx auch gestartet ?

    z.B. mit
    “sudo launchctl load -w /Library/LaunchDaemons/org.macports.tuntaposx.plist”

    Ich hatte Deinen Fehler nämlich auch, da ich tuntaposx lediglich installiert aber nicht gestartet hatte. Nach dem Starten lief das Script dann einwandfrei und die Verbindung konnte aufgebaut werden.

    Gruß
    Grindl

  4. Bernd

    Hi, kann ich das auch mit meinem HTC Magic machen oder wäre die Mühe umsonst und mir fliegt alles um die Ohren?

    Freue mich auf Eure Hilfe.
    Bernd

  5. Phantom

    @BERND: Es sollte auch mit dem HTC Magic funktionieren.

    Da mein Mac neu aufgesetzt wurde, musste ich auch die PORTS neu installieren. Dadurch musste ich auch das Script modifizieren, da die Einstellungen nicht mehr passten.

    http://pastie.org/private/clyjbyzek9qgbnkjotug

    Nicht vergessen, nach
    d.) “install openvpn2″ eingeben

    den neuen Punkt (e) ausführen:
    e.) ”install tuntaposx” eingeben

    Systeminformationen:
    Mac OS X: 10.6.3

    Ports:
    - openvpn2 @2.1.1_1
    - tuntaposx @20090913_+universal

Hinterlasse einen Kommentar!